Web30 Sep 2024 · Matrix completion is the study of recovering an underlying matrix from a sparse subset of noisy observations. Traditionally, it is assumed that the entries of the matrix are "missing completely at random" (MCAR), i.e., each entry is revealed at random, independent of everything else, with uniform probability. Web12 Feb 2024 · Matrix Subjects and Matrix Verbs "(17) a. Mary wondered [whether Bill would leave]. . . . "The clause of which the subordinate clause is a constituent, such as Mary wondered whether Bill would leave in (17a), is referred to as the higher clause or the matrix clause.
